Analysis
In 2024, reserves excluding gold, foreign exchange in Ghana stood at 3.34 billion SDR.
That represents a change of up 53.4% on the previous year and down 1.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, reserves excluding gold, foreign exchange in Ghana peaked at 5.93 billion SDR in 2021 and was at its lowest, 30.21 million SDR, in 1971.
That places Ghana 103rd out of 194 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1950s | 254.20 million SDR | 141.40 million SDR | 335.50 million SDR | 10 |
| 1960s | 126.32 million SDR | 66.20 million SDR | 266.70 million SDR | 10 |
| 1970s | 100.41 million SDR | 30.21 million SDR | 205.79 million SDR | 10 |
| 1980s | 220.37 million SDR | 124.49 million SDR | 418.42 million SDR | 10 |
| 1990s | 326.93 million SDR | 150.70 million SDR | 557.39 million SDR | 10 |
| 2000s | 960.68 million SDR | 177.69 million SDR | 1.87 billion SDR | 10 |
| 2010s | 3.72 billion SDR | 2.80 billion SDR | 5.05 billion SDR | 10 |
| 2020s | 3.95 billion SDR | 2.17 billion SDR | 5.93 billion SDR | 5 |
